KML Balloons in Google Earth – starting with version 5.0 – support HTML, CSS, and almost full JavaScript. This can be a great tool for developers looking to add rich content and interactivity into their KML files. However, it’s not always obvious how to debug that KML content. According to research firm International Data Corporation (IDC), the Western European mobile phone market grew 7.5% year on year to 50.7 million units in 3Q10. Shipments of smartphones increased to 19 million units, 109% higher than the previous year’s third quarter, to represent 37% of total shipments. More and more users are moving to mobile...Read More
